The Los Angeles Department of Public Health recommends several tips to reduce the risk of West Nile Virus infection:- Avoid mosquito-infested areas at dawn and dusk.-Use insect repellent. -Cover up.-Take steps to control mosquitoes indoors and outdoors.For more information and additional tips, visit: http://PublicHealth.LACounty.gov/media/westnile/
